Gold-silver ratio slumps sharply: What does it signal for investors? Explained

In April 2025, selling 1 kg of gold would fetch roughly 110 kg of silver. Today, that same 1 kg of gold gets you only about 47 kg of silver. This is not a marginal move — it represents a structural repricing of silver relative to gold, said Harshal Dasani, Business Head at INVAsset PMS.
